Modern dentistry is largely painless. We use effective local anesthesia for all procedures that might cause discomfort. Most patients report feeling pressure but no pain during treatment. Dr. Nirali specializes in gentle, anxiety-free dentistry and takes extra care to ensure your comfort. For anxious patients, we can discuss sedation options.
A typical root canal takes 60-90 minutes per visit. Simple cases can be completed in a single visit, while complex cases may require multiple visits. We'll explain the timeline during your consultation based on your specific situation. The procedure is done under local anesthesia, so you won't feel pain during treatment.
With proper care, dental implants can last 20-30 years or even a lifetime. They have a 95-98% success rate. The key to longevity is good oral hygiene (brushing, flossing) and regular dental check-ups. We use premium implants with manufacturer warranties.

Professional in-office teeth whitening takes about 60-90 minutes and delivers immediate results (2-4 shades whiter in one sitting). How long results last varies by individual and depends on your diet and oral hygiene habits. Avoiding coffee, tea, red wine, and tobacco helps maintain results longer. Touch-up treatments are available when needed.
Average treatment time is 12-24 months, but it varies based on the complexity of your case. Minor corrections may take 6-12 months, while severe misalignment can require 24-36 months. Clear aligners often work faster than traditional braces for mild to moderate cases. We'll provide a personalized timeline during your consultation.
